The Bedale-Gilling Sword was a short sword of golden hilt and decorated blade.
Layla Hassan, an Assassin who relieved Eivor Varinsdottir's memories, modified her Animus and included this sword as part of the shieldmaiden's arsenal.[1]

Behind the scenes
Maxime Durand, one of the historical researchers for Ubisoft, said on Twitter that the Assassin's Creed: Valhalla developers worked with Sue Brunning, the curator of Early Medieval Europe Collections at the British Museum and a specialist in early medieval swords, to make an in-game model of the Gilling sword.[2]
